NOS as in nitrous oxide? What size shot? I can see why the engines blew....spiking the cylinder pressure on an engine that already is high compression and on the edge from the factory....

I can only imagine what cylinder pressures would be at high rpm and with nitrous

Nitrous can be run safely, if using all the safeguards it requires. But the extreme cylinder pressures at high rpm with the high compression ration leaves no room for error.
